📅  最后修改于: 2023-12-03 15:39:36.852000             🧑  作者: Mango
在选择 Linux 文件系统时,需要考虑可靠性、性能、安全性和可扩展性等因素。 下面是几种常用的 Linux 文件系统和它们的优缺点:
ext4 是 Linux 中最常见的文件系统之一,它是 ext3 的后继版本。它具有高性能、稳定性和可靠性,支持大容量文件。
缺点是对于磁盘数据丢失的恢复较难。
建议在桌面和服务器场景中使用 ext4。
XFS 是 SGI 公司开发的文件系统,特别适合大容量的文件系统。它比 ext4 更快,具有更好的性能和扩展性,同时也支持实时备份和恢复。
XFS 适合用于服务器和高性能计算机。
btrfs 是 Linux 中较新的文件系统之一,它具有非常好的可扩展性和数据保护。btrfs 采用了诸多先进的数据保护技术,如快照、多副本等。
缺点是btrfs 有仍然有很多新特性还在发展阶段,其生态不够健全。
建议在需要存储大型数据段和需要可扩展性和容错性的场合使用 btrfs。
ZFS 是另一种高级文件系统,其具有与 btrfs 相似的特点,如数据快照、数据校验等。ZFS 的文件系统图像非常大,因为它将文件系统管理和逻辑卷管理集成到了一起。ZFS 还提供了快照、克隆、压缩等高级特性。
缺点是 ZFS 有强依赖性,可能会导致许可证问题。
建议在服务器场景中使用 ZFS。
在您选择文件系统之前,请仔细考虑该文件系统背后的需求和所需的保护水平。在所需的安全、性能和可靠性特性之间进行权衡,视您的需求而进行选择。
# 您应该使用哪个 Linux 文件系统?
在选择 Linux 文件系统时,需要考虑可靠性、性能、安全性和可扩展性等因素。 下面是几种常用的 Linux 文件系统和它们的优缺点:
## ext4
ext4 是 Linux 中最常见的文件系统之一,它是 ext3 的后继版本。它具有高性能、稳定性和可靠性,支持大容量文件。
缺点是对于磁盘数据丢失的恢复较难。
建议在桌面和服务器场景中使用 ext4。
## XFS
XFS 是 SGI 公司开发的文件系统,特别适合大容量的文件系统。它比 ext4 更快,具有更好的性能和扩展性,同时也支持实时备份和恢复。
XFS 适合用于服务器和高性能计算机。
## btrfs
btrfs 是 Linux 中较新的文件系统之一,它具有非常好的可扩展性和数据保护。btrfs 采用了诸多先进的数据保护技术,如快照、多副本等。
缺点是btrfs 有仍然有很多新特性还在发展阶段,其生态不够健全。
建议在需要存储大型数据段和需要可扩展性和容错性的场合使用 btrfs。
## ZFS
ZFS 是另一种高级文件系统,其具有与 btrfs 相似的特点,如数据快照、数据校验等。ZFS 的文件系统图像非常大,因为它将文件系统管理和逻辑卷管理集成到了一起。ZFS 还提供了快照、克隆、压缩等高级特性。
缺点是 ZFS 有强依赖性,可能会导致许可证问题。
建议在服务器场景中使用 ZFS。
## Conclusion
在您选择文件系统之前,请仔细考虑该文件系统背后的需求和所需的保护水平。在所需的安全、性能和可靠性特性之间进行权衡,视您的需求而进行选择。